Edging is the practice of developing tidy, specified boundaries between various landscape components, such as yards, garden beds, pathways, and patios. Appropriate edging boosts the visual appeal of a residential or commercial property, prevents grass from trespassing into flower beds, and makes upkeep jobs like trimming much easier and more exact. Techniques include setting up physical barriers like metal, plastic, or stone edging, as well as shaping soil or grass to develop natural limits. Material choice and installation techniques vary depending on the preferred visual, landscape design, and long-lasting resilience. Regular upkeep of edges prevents overgrowth, maintains crisp lines, and contributes to a refined, deliberate look. Effective edging is both a practical tool and a style aspect, enhancing the overall company and beauty of a landscape
